Shook Steak:

Ingredients:
16 oz steak
1/3 cup seasoned breadcrumbs
1/4 cup olive or vegetable oil
3 Tablespoons Monterey Steak Seasoning
1 Teaspoon Pepper
2 Mid-size Mixing Bowls
Half an Orange Sliced

1. Slice steak into approximately ten thin strips, 4 inches long, and 1/3- 1/5 inch think.

2. Coat the bottom of a mixing bowl in olive oil, and roll strips in oil until coated.

3. Cover tops of strips in steak seasoning and pepper

4. Pour Breadcrumbs over steak slices

5. Place second mixing bowl on top of first (or use lid) and shake the contents thorughly for 60 seconds.

6. Let steak slices sit for 1-2 hours

7. Preheat Oven to Broil

8. Drizzle Orange Juice Over Slices on Broiling Pan

9. Cook to desired rarity
